html中onload用法 document.ready和onload的区别?
document.ready和onload的区别?
1. Load是在页面上所有资源(包括DOM文档树、CSS文件、JS文件、图片资源等)加载完毕后执行一个函数。问题:如果图像资源多,加载时间长,则onload后等待执行的函数需要等待很长时间,可能会影响一些效果。2$(文档)。Ready()是在加载DOM文档树之后执行的一个函数(不包括图片、CSS等),执行速度比加载快。在本机JS中,不包括ready()方法。绘制DOM结构后,只执行load方法,即onload event
ready event。这确保了即使没有加载大量媒体文件,也可以执行JS代码。在加载网页中的所有内容之前,无法执行加载事件。如果网页中有大量图片,则会出现这种情况:web文档已呈现,但由于web数据尚未完全加载,因此无法立即触发加载事件。实际上,如果页面上没有图片等媒体文件,ready与load类似,但如果页面上有文件,则不同,因此建议在工作中使用ready。
jQuery中ready和load的区别?
IE的脚本元素支持onreadystatechange事件,但不支持onload事件。FF的script元素不支持onreadystatechange事件,只支持onload事件。如果你想在一个此.readyState值“loaded”或“complete”表示脚本已加载。如何结合IE和FF的区别?请参阅jQuery源代码:varscript=文档.createElement(“脚本”)脚本.src="https://img.kmw.com xx.js公司" script.onload=脚本.onreadystatechange=function(){if(!this.readyState//这是FF的判断语句,因为FF没有readyState值,即readyState必须有值| |this.readyState==“已加载”| |this.readyState==“Complete”//这是IE的判断句{alert(“loaded”)}
准备好:vt。准备好:vt。主席今天来仓库了,所以,站在你的塔楼上,准备好回答董事会主席今天要来看仓库的任何问题。你应该小心,随时准备回答他的问题。
2. 因为你大声喊叫!难道你还没准备好出门吗!你还没准备好出去吗?
如果你这么愚蠢,你必须准备好承担后果。
4. 相反地,刚刚开始在遥远世界发展的智能生物可能在几千年后就可以接收到我们的信号。这些幼苗很快就可以在边境种植了。这家商店把夏天的存货卖了,以备冬天进货。
onreadystatechange与onload有啥区别吗?
当您说$时,通常指的是jQuery对象。Onload是一个本机HTML事件。当使用jQuery时,它通常使用$(document)。准备就绪()。两者的区别如下:1。执行时间window.onload文件必须等到页面中的所有元素(包括图片)都已加载。$(文档)。Ready()在绘制DOM结构之后执行,而不必等待加载完成。
2. 编译器的数量不同window.onload文件如果存在多个,则不能同时写入多个window.onload文件方法,只执行一个$(文档)。Ready()可以同时写入多个文件,并且所有文件都可以执行。3window.onload文件没有编写$(文档)的简化方法。就绪(function(){})可以缩写为$(function(){})
be ready to和be ready for的区别?
$(document)。Ready()在文档加载后执行;$(function(){})与上面相同,因为jQuery默认为Ready,所以执行能力是相同的;<script>functiona(){XXX}a()</script>以functiona(){}形式编写的函数是全局函数,可以在调用它们的任何地方访问和执行<bodyonload=“a()”></body>加载主体后,调用a()函数没有区别。执行力完全一样
html中onload用法 js中onload和ready区别 ready2download啥意思
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。